Where to Stay
From sitting hearthside at a charming inn to unwinding in a remote cabin tucked into the woods, Almaguin’s accommodations set the stage for romance. Fern Glen Inn and Brimacombe Bay B&B offer warmth and comfort, while Deer Lake Wilderness Retreat, Trailhead Cabins, Pit Stop 518, Edgewater Park Lodge, and Scarlett Point Resort deliver that perfect rustic getaway vibe. Eat & Drink
Warm up with a visit to Copperhead Distillery and take home a bottle of moonshine to keep the cold at bay. When hunger strikes, Almaguin offers plenty of ways to fill your heart—and your stomach. Grab a take-home pizza from Katrine Pizza to enjoy fireside, or indulge in a cozy meal at Red Canoe Restaurant in Kearney. For a morning pick-me-up, SIPS serves coffee with a view, while Bernard’s Bistro pairs comfort food with frozen lake scenery that’s sure to melt your heart.
Things to Do
If your idea of romance includes a little excitement, Almaguin delivers. Try a dog sledding workshop with Sugardogs Adventure Co. and enjoy teamwork, laughter, and maybe even a little snow in your face. For something more relaxed and unique, Crystal Cave offers a memorable indoor adventure and the perfect place to find a keepsake.

Get Moving
If you want to keep moving during your getaway, Sweat Studio in Sundridge offers spin and yoga classes—a great way to balance indulgence with activity. Prefer classic winter fun? Lace up your skates and visit the outdoor rinks in Novar, Emsdale, or Katrine for a relaxed and playful outing.
Look Up
Don’t forget to take a break from the day and look up. The Almaguin region is home to some of Ontario’s darkest and most impressive night skies. Whether you’re an experienced stargazer with an Orion SkyQuest XT10 or XT12, or a beginner using a stargazing app like Stellarium, Almaguin offers exceptional opportunities to experience the night sky.
